AI Summary

  • Creates four new felony offenses in the Penal Law for vehicular assault and manslaughter in active work zones, with severity based on mental state (criminal negligence vs. recklessness) and outcome (serious injury vs. death)

  • Vehicular assault in an active work zone: second degree (criminal negligence causing serious injury) is a class E felony; first degree (reckless conduct causing serious injury) is a class D felony

  • Vehicular manslaughter in an active work zone: second degree (criminal negligence causing death) is a class C felony; first degree (reckless conduct causing death) is a class B felony

  • Establishes a new class B misdemeanor for unauthorized intrusion into an active work zone by drivers, bicyclists, or pedestrians, punishable by $250-$500 fine, up to 3 months imprisonment, or both

  • Defines "active work zone" as an area on public highways, streets, or private roads where construction, maintenance, or utility work is being conducted, properly marked with signs, cones, or traffic control devices, and where workers are physically present

Legislative Description

Establishes the crimes of vehicular assault and vehicular manslaughter in an active work zone and intrusion into an active work zone.
